怎么用js和html计算商品总价,并与商品数量联动,从td获取数据并赋值到td。

怎么用js和html计算商品总价,并与商品数量联动,从td获取数据并赋值到td。,第1张

给你说下思路, document.getElementById("top").rows.length可以获得top表的行数 document.getElementById("top").rows[0].cells.length可以获得top表的第一行的列数 document.getElementById("top").rows[0].cells[0].offsetWidth可获得top表第一行第一列的实际宽度,(注意,这个是只读的!)所以 for(var i=0i

第一个人的回答是不对的,td要用innerTEXT的,但是firefox不支持这个属性!

所以就要像第二个回答这样,在td中加一个div,然后用innerHTML。

然后你可以遍历数组

for(var i=0,i<data.lengthi++){

document.getElementById('aa').innerHTML=document.getElementById('aa').innerHTML+data[i]

}

或者

varinner=""

for(var i=0,i<data.lengthi++){

inner+=data[i]

}

document.getElementById('aa').innerHTML=inner

不过数组的

第三个人也是错误的,要给input赋值的话,要用value

var value=document.getElementById("name")

value.value=data[0]

另外 变量名称不要用name啊value啊等这样的敏感的单词!

如果使用Jquery,可以使用$("#aa").text(inner)这样的办法!


欢迎分享,转载请注明来源:内存溢出

原文地址: https://www.outofmemory.cn/zaji/7276004.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-03
下一篇 2023-04-03

发表评论

登录后才能评论

评论列表(0条)

保存